Why Choose Aluminium for Your Motor Boat?
Aluminium has become one of the most popular materials for motor boats, especially for DIY builders. Here’s why:
- Lightweight and Strong: Aluminium offers an excellent strength-to-weight ratio, making your boat easier to handle both in and out of the water.
- Corrosion Resistance: Unlike steel, aluminium resists rust, extending the longevity of your boat with minimal maintenance.
- Durability: Aluminium boats can withstand impacts better than fiberglass, making them ideal for rugged waters and shallow areas.
- Eco-Friendly: Aluminium is recyclable, reducing the environmental impact compared to other materials.
- Cost-Effective: While initial costs can vary, aluminium boats often require less upkeep over the years, saving money in the long run.
Understanding Aluminium Motor Boat Plans
Aluminium motor boat plans are detailed blueprints that guide you through every step of building your boat. They typically include:
- Dimensions and Measurements: Precise lengths, widths, and heights to ensure the boat’s proper size and balance.
- Material Lists: Specifications on aluminium thickness, types of sheets, and other materials needed.
- Construction Techniques: Instructions on cutting, bending, welding, and assembling aluminium components.
- Design Features: Hull shape, seating arrangements, motor mounts, and storage options tailored to various uses.
- Safety Guidelines: Recommendations to ensure structural integrity and compliance with boating standards.
Well-designed plans take the guesswork out of the building process, saving you time and reducing costly mistakes.
Types of Aluminium Motor Boat Plans
Depending on your intended use and skill level, there are different types of aluminium motor boat plans:
- Simple Flat-Bottom Boats: Ideal for calm lakes and rivers, these plans are beginner-friendly and quick to build.
- V-Hull Boats: Designed for better performance in choppy waters, these plans require more advanced construction skills.
- Catamaran Designs: Offering stability and speed, catamarans are excellent for fishing and watersports.
- Custom Plans: Tailored to your specific requirements, these may include luxury features or specialized configurations.
How to Choose the Right Aluminium Motor Boat Plans for Your Project
Choosing the best aluminium motor boat plans involves considering several factors to match your capabilities and needs:
Skill Level and Experience
Assess your welding, metalworking, and boat-building skills honestly. Beginners should start with simpler flat-bottom plans before progressing to V-hull or catamaran designs. Plans that include step-by-step instructions and support materials are invaluable for novices.
Intended Use
Think about how you plan to use your boat. Are you looking for a fishing boat, a leisure cruiser, or a workboat? The hull design and size will vary depending on the purpose.
Size and Capacity
Consider how many people or how much cargo you intend to carry. Plans will specify seating arrangements and load limits, so choose accordingly.
Budget and Materials
Factor in the cost of aluminium sheets, welding equipment, and additional hardware. Some plans optimize material usage to reduce waste and expense.
Support and Documentation
High-quality plans often come with customer support, video tutorials, and detailed diagrams. These resources can be crucial, especially if you encounter challenges during construction.

Essential Tools and Materials for Building Your Aluminium Motor Boat
Before starting construction, ensure you have the right tools and materials on hand:
Tools
- Metal cutting saw or plasma cutter
- Welding machine (TIG or MIG recommended for aluminium)
- Measuring tape and square
- Clamps and jigs
- Deburring and sanding tools
- Protective gear (welding helmet, gloves, respirator)
Materials
- Marine-grade aluminium sheets (thickness as per plan)
- Aluminium welding rods or wire
- Sealants and primers suitable for aluminium
- Hardware such as rivets, screws, and fasteners
- Paints or coatings for finishing
Step-by-Step Guide to Building an Aluminium Motor Boat
While each plan varies, the general building process follows these stages:
1. Preparation and Planning
Study your chosen plans thoroughly. Prepare your workspace with adequate ventilation and a clean floor. Order all materials and inspect them upon arrival.
2. Cutting Aluminium Sheets
Using precise measurements from the plans, cut aluminium sheets carefully. Mark each piece to avoid confusion during assembly.
3. Forming and Bending
Depending on your design, bend aluminium panels to shape the hull and other components. Use clamps and jigs to hold pieces firmly.
4. Welding and Assembly
Join aluminium pieces using appropriate welding techniques. Take your time to ensure strong, clean welds—this stage is critical for the boat’s integrity.
5. Sealing and Finishing
Apply sealants to prevent water ingress. Sand welded areas smooth and apply coatings or paints for corrosion resistance and aesthetics.
6. Installing Hardware and Motor
Attach seats, cleats, motor mounts, and other fittings as per plan instructions. Ensure all installations are secure and aligned correctly.
7. Final Inspection and Testing
Perform a thorough inspection for any leaks, weak welds, or misalignments. Test your boat in safe, calm waters before venturing further.
Common Challenges and How to Overcome Them
Building an aluminium motor boat is complex and may present obstacles:
- Welding Difficulties: Aluminium welding requires skill and the right equipment. Practice on scrap pieces before working on the boat.
- Material Handling: Aluminium sheets can be sharp and tricky to maneuver. Use gloves and proper lifting techniques.
- Precision Work: Small measurement errors can affect boat performance. Double-check all dimensions before cutting or welding.
- Environmental Factors: Work in a clean, dry area to avoid contamination and ensure proper welds.
